Gilt für
Host Integration Server 2013 Host Integration Server 2016

Problembeschreibung

Wenn ein Host Integration Server-Client die CryptAcquireContext -Funktion verwenden versucht, schlägt die Funktion fehl und NTE_PROV_TYPE_NO_MATCH unter Umständen zurückgegeben

Ursache

Dieses Problem tritt aufgrund ein falschen Anbietertyp, wie im folgenden Beispiel angegeben wird:

CryptAcquireContext ( & hProv, NULL, MS_ENH_RSA_AES_PROV, PROV_RSA_FULL, CRYPT_NEWKEYSET) error: 8009 001B

Wenn der erste Aufruf der CryptAcquireContext -Funktion fehlschlägt (gibt false zurück) und der NTE_BAD_KEYSET Fehler, eine zweite Anforderung gesendet wird, die CRYPT_NEWKEYSETverwendet. Dieser Anruf verwendet jedoch den falschen Typ.

In diesem Fall erhalten Sie die folgende Fehlermeldung angezeigt:

Typ ist registrierten Wert nicht überein.

Problemlösung

Das Update, das dieses Problem behebt ist in die folgenden kumulativen Updates für Host Integration Server enthalten:

Kumulative Update 2 für Host Integrationsserver 2016

Kumulative Update 4 für Host Integrationsserver 2013

Status

Microsoft hat bestätigt, dass es sich um ein Problem bei den Microsoft-Produkten handelt, die im Abschnitt „Eigenschaften“ aufgeführt sind.

Referenzen

Erfahren Sie mehr über die Terminologie, welche Microsoft verwendet, um Softwareupdates zu beschrieben.

Benötigen Sie weitere Hilfe?

Möchten Sie weitere Optionen?

Erkunden Sie die Abonnementvorteile, durchsuchen Sie Trainingskurse, erfahren Sie, wie Sie Ihr Gerät schützen und vieles mehr.